  • SummaryBrooklyn Dodgers pitcher Dazzy Vance sitting on a coiled water hose and showing grip on a baseball to a player seated with him (identified on verso as Jimmy Pattison); unpainted wooden building with water spigot behind them; location unknown, perhaps spring training facility.
